Saturday Night Live star Marcello Hernandez's whirlwind summer continued this week with an appearance on Watch What Happens Live. The comedian faced dating rumors and shared a behind-the-scenes story from the cultural event of the year.
During Hernandez's conversation with Andy Cohen on Monday night, a fan asked the Saturday Night Live cast member his thoughts on a viral rumor. According to gossip, reality television star Paige DeSorbo cheated on then-boyfriend Craig Conover with Hernandez.
The comedian quickly shut down the rumor and made sure to come with receipts in case anyone wasn't buying his story. Hernandez took out his phone and read a text exchange with DeSorbo in which she tipped him off to the rumors spreading on TikTok.
"TikTok wants me to be Domingo. Marcello Hernandez, the homewrecking Latino," he responded. Unfortunately for fans hoping for reality TV tea, Hernandez is nothing like his famous SNL character. He made sure to tell Cohen that he did not find the story amusing. Hernandez has been dating artist Ana Amelia Batlle Cabral for some time.
Cabral accompanied Hernandez to the wedding of Taylor Swift and Travis Kelce earlier this summer. So of course, that topic also came up during the Watch What Happens Live interview.
"The most surprising thing I saw at the wedding was Tom Cruise," Hernandez told Cohen. "I got to talk to Tom Cruise, and he grew up in a house full of women, and we got to relate about that."
Hernandez also went on to shut down his 72 Hours co-star Kevin Hart, who claimed Hernandez was sending him videos of the wedding. The ceremony at Madison Square Garden was famously a phone-free event, so Hernandez made sure he didn't get in trouble with the newlyweds.

But when it comes to work, Hernandez has been incredibly busy this summer. He appeared in promotional content for the FIFA World Cup, hosted the ESPYs, and is now making the rounds to promote 72 Hours. By the time his summer finally quiets down, it will be time to get back to Studio 8H for season 52 of Saturday Night Live.
